Need a bit of help lads, My newly rebuilt engine has about 450 miles on her now and I'm giving her a bit stick now, but sometimes at around 8k it just falls off a cliff so to speak so I shut it off and bike seems fine, it doesn't always do it sometimes it revs all the way and pulls through the gears lovely, but it's a bit worrying any thoughts as to what it may be?
Fully rebuilt f2 engine new powervalves seals etc, carbs rebuilt new jets seats airline through them emulsion tubes etc. The timings fixed on these isn't it so I'm stumped

Post by jon on May 28, 2017 8:18:56 GMT 1
It's so difficult to diagnose without riding the bike yourself.
However one possibility could be the CDI breaking down intermittently. I think I'd try another one as a quick test.

Well I'm nearly certain it's electrical guys, been out tonight it pulls right round in each gear fine, but when I'm in top and at about 90-95 it cuts power instantly. No splutter just looses power feels flat, slow down and it's fine again, so either coils or as was suggested earlier cdi unit or generator. I'm thinking cheaper to try a coil first? Thoughts please?
